<pre>AX: Crash at AccessibilityRenderObject::computeAccessibilityIsIgnored const + 552
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=161276
Reviewed by Chris Fleizach.
Sometimes when calling JavaScript removeChild or setAttribute on a node, it seems like
the renderer is deallocated during the process of computeAccessibilityIsIgnored. It's
causing a crash when we are accessing the renderer after that. Since RenderObject is not ref
counted and we cannot hold onto it for the duration of the function, fixed it by adding
more nil checks.
Despite my best efforts, I couldn't make a layout test that destroys the renderer within
the computeAccessibilityIsIgnored function.
* accessibility/AccessibilityRenderObject.cpp:
(WebCore::AccessibilityRenderObject::computeAccessibilityIsIgnored):</pre>
